Newmont Mining Corporation NEM (Newmont or the Company) announced it has changed the release date of its 2019 guidance and updated longer term outlook to Thursday, December 6, 2018 in observance of the National Day of Mourning for President George H. W. Bush and closure of U.S. financial markets. The Company will hold a conference call at 10:00 a.m. Eastern Time (8:00 a.m. Mountain Time) the same day.

The revised date of Newmont's 2019 guidance and updated longer term outlook is one day later than previously announced in the Company's initial release on October 30, 2018.

About Newmont

Newmont is a leading gold and copper producer. The Company's operations are primarily in the United States, Australia, Ghana, Peru and Suriname. Newmont is the only gold producer listed in the S&P 500 Index and was named the mining industry leader by the Dow Jones Sustainability World Index in 2015, 2016, 2017 and 2018. The Company is an industry leader in value creation, supported by its leading technical, environmental, social and safety performance. Newmont was founded in 1921 and has been publicly traded since 1925.
